Anything can happen in a live show.

In a recent interview, ’80s icon Rick Springfield spoke about the “craziest thing” that ever happened to him during a live show. Naturally, the rocker had some pretty good stories in his back pocket.

View this post on Instagram

A post shared by Rick Springfield (@rickspringfield)

In a recent interview with the New York Post, the “Jessie’s Girl” singer was asked: “What is the craziest thing to have happened at a live show of yours?”

First he mentioned famous ballet dancer Rudolf Nuryev watching one of his shows from the side of the stage, which he called “pretty out there.” But then the rocker recalled an embarrassing moment of his.

“I played half a show with my fly open — I thought everyone was looking at my my mighty man bulge and going — but my fly was open,” he said. “That was humiliating.”

Of course, Springfield has enough cool points to cancel out the fly incident. Not only was he an ’80s rock icon with several songs in the top 20 on the Billboard Hot 100 chart, as well as a soap opera star on General Hospital, but Springfield is still at it on tour and breaking hearts. He’s currently part of the “I Want My ’80s Tour,” which runs through August 10.
